| 1) |
Pressure in refrigerant circuits is maintained at
approximately 2 bar (29 psi), regulated by A/C compressor, even though
heat transfer changes and engine speeds vary. However, this applies only
within the performance range of the A/C compressor; if the performance
limits of the A/C compressor are exceeded, the pressure increases. Refer
to
→ Chapter „Pressures, Checking“. |
| 2) |
Within the control range of the A/C compressor,
temperature in the refrigerant circuits is maintained, regulated by A/C
compressor, even though heat transfer changes and engine speeds vary.
However, this applies only within the performance range of the A/C
compressor; if the performance limits of the A/C compressor are
exceeded, the temperature increases. Refer to
→ Chapter „Pressures, Checking“. |
| 3) |
Measured values for A/C systems with two evaporators |
Note
| A/C compressors which do not regulate their performance are
switched off by the respective control module via the A/C
Compressor Regulator Valve -N280- at an evaporator temperature
below 0 °C (32 °F). |
| In vehicles with A/C Compressor Regulator Valve -N280-, the
pressure is modified on the low pressure side by the valve. |
